99 vw jetta rpm's

I recently purchased a 99 vw new jetta gls, automatic transmission, 4 cylinder 2.0. with 60,000 miles on it.Since this is my first vw I'm not sure what's normal and what's not. My rpm's seem to be running high 3000rpms at 65 mph, 2800 rpms at 60 mph. I've never driven a car that has that high of a reading, of course I'm use driving larger suv's so I don't know what is normal for a small car.. This is my main concern at the moment other than sometimes when I'm just starting out the transmission seems to shift a little hard when going from 1st to 2nd gear. Any help from experienced vw owners would be helpful.
